摘要:根据对乌兰布和沙漠东北部4种白刺植物群落的样地调查数据,采用物种丰富度指数S、Shannon-Wiener指数H'、Simpson指数D、Pielou均匀度指数J、Alatalo均匀度指数Ea、Whittaker指数βw、相异性系数CD、群落共有度Jaccard指数CP、Bray-Curtis指数CN等指标研究了该地区4种白刺群落分层的α多样性和β多样性。结果表明:这些α多样性和β多样性测度指标有效表征了干旱沙漠区同属不同植物群落内部在物种组成方面的差异、生境差异、群落间物种组成差异。四种白刺群落的草本层的物种丰富度指数都明显大于灌木层;唐古特白刺群落的物种丰富度指数最小,泡泡刺群落的物种多样性Shannon-Wiener指数H'和Simpson指数D最大,而且其群落均匀度也最大。唐古特白刺植物群落的Whittaker指数βw要比其它三种白刺群落要大,若仅考虑群落间共有物种数目多少,大白刺与泡泡刺在群落、灌木层与草本层间的相异性系数CD都最小,共有度Jaccard指数CP都最大;而西伯利亚白刺群落、灌木层和草本层与其余三种白刺的相异性系数CD都较大,Jaccard指数CP都较小。而数量数据指标Bray-Curtis指数CN变化与上述有所不同。采用植物盖度和相对盖度进行α多样性和β多样性对比分析,能够合理地说明不同白刺植物多样性特征。
Four Nitraria communities ( N. tangutorum, N. sphaerocarpa, N. roborowskii and N. sibirica ) in northeastern Ulanbuh Desert were surveyed with the quadrate. The plant diversity characteristics of the communities and the shrub layers and the herb layers were measured by applying the richness index, Shannon - Wiener index, Simpson index, Pielou evenness index, Alatalo evenness index for α -diversity and Whittaker index, Community Dissimilarity index, Jaccard index, Bray - Curtis index for β - diversity. These indices could effectively reveal the difference of species formation and habitat of different plant communities of same genus in arid sand area. The species richness index of herb layer is evidently bigger than the shrub layer in four Nitraria com- munities. The richness index of N.tangutorum is minimum, and.Shannon - Wiener index and Simpson index and two evenness indices of N. sphaerocarpa are maximum. The Whittaker index of N. tangutorum community is bigger than the other three Nitraria communities. The minimum Community Dissimilarity index and maximum Jaccard index of the community and the shrub layer and herb layer exist between N. sphaerocarpa and N. roborowskii. And the Community Dissimilarity index of the community and the shrub layer and herb layer between N. sibirica and the other three Nitraria spp. is bigger than the others, and the Jaccard index is lesser. But the Bray- Curtis index measured by numerical data is partly different with the above. The α -diversity indices measured by cover data and β- diversity indices measured by relative cover data,could reasonably show thee plant diversity characteristics of different species of same genus Nitraria L.
